From 2d019ddc93c8139950c92ba09a3234f12462d024 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Richard Moe Gustavsen Date: Tue, 22 Apr 2014 12:57:37 +0200 Subject: iOS: scroll screen after hiding keyboard programatically M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it When the keyboard is told to hide, we resign first responder. If this is done programatically on touch press, this will make the "hide keyboard gesture" receive a touchesCancelled instead of a touchesEnded. Since we didn't catch this from before, the gesture was left in a mixed state causing the screen not to scroll when later showing the keyboard.
